Horizontal Gene Transfer
Horizontal gene transfer (HGT) refers to the process by which an organism incorporates genetic material from another organism without being its offspring. This mechanism allows for the exchange of genes between different species, contributing to genetic diversity and the evolution of traits such as antibiotic resistance. In bacteria, HGT can occur through transformation, transduction, or conjugation, significantly impacting their adaptability and survival.

Point Mutations
Point mutations are changes in a single nucleotide base pair in the DNA sequence of a gene. These mutations can be classified as missense mutations, which result in a different amino acid being incorporated into a protein, or synonymous mutations, which do not change the amino acid sequence. Understanding point mutations is crucial for studying genetic variation and the functional consequences of genetic changes in organisms.

Bacillus anthracis and Anthrax
Bacillus anthracis is a bacterium that causes anthrax, a serious infectious disease. It can form spores that survive in harsh conditions, making it a potent pathogen. The study of its genetic variations, such as those identified in the toxin transport protein, helps researchers understand the epidemiology of anthrax and the genetic factors that contribute to its virulence and transmission among hosts.
